Optimize the dismantling of your illuminated decorations: Practical advice

The end of the illumination season marks an important turning point for the management of your illuminated decorations. For efficient and rapid dismantling, good planning is essential. In February and March, organize dismantling waves according to the types of decorations, and ensure that your experienced teams are ready to quickly identify equipment failures. Store your decorations in a dry and well-ventilated environment to ensure their durability. In addition, do not wait until autumn to carry out the necessary repairs: take advantage of the low season to benefit from advantageous rates and shorter repair times. 5 tips to create a Wow effect on any budget

Want to create an impressive lighting project but have a limited budget? No problem! It is entirely possible to achieve a stunning result by following a few key tips. Opt for a phased approach to spread your expenses while maintaining a strong visual impact. Use the "One in Two" strategy to distribute your decorations and maximize the effect over a larger area. Add variation to your decorative elements to surprise and amaze viewers. Integrate daytime elements that will retain their beauty even in broad daylight, and don't forget to add dynamic animation accessories to bring your decor to life.
